Web to add a citation, select the desired location for the citation in your document, click the insert citation command on the references tab, and select add new source. Click where you want to insert a citation. Web put your cursor at the end of the text you want to cite. Go to references > style , and choose a citation style. Web select the source you want, and word correctly inserts the citation into the document. Enter the requested information for the source—like the author name, title, and publication details—then click ok.
